horsewhip wrote:Okay. A lot of the bands mentioned on this thread are really good, but seriously, who the fuck on this board has NOT heard of The Melvins, Neurosis, or Helmet? Come ooooooooooon! Give me a fucking breeeeeeeaak!

Let me run down my MP3 player and list some awesome records from the last five years that aren't by Shellac:

A-Frames "Black Forest"
Agoraphobic Nosebleed "Frozen Corpse Stuffed With Dope"
Akimbo "City Of The Stars"
Baseball Furies "Greater Than Ever"
Black Cross "Art Offensive" and "Widows, Bloody Widows"
The Blind Shake "Rizzograph"
Breather Resist "Charmer"
Call Me Lightning "The Trouble We're In"
Coliseum S/T
Dirtbombs "Dangerous Magical Noise"
Doomriders "Black Thunder"
Federation X "X-Patriot"
Fleshies "Kill The Dreamer's Dream" and "The Sicilian"
Japanther "Wolfenswan"
JR Ewing "Ride Paranoia" (Avoid the new one.)
Knockout Pills "1+1 = ATE"
Pig Destroyer "Terrifyer"
Planes Mistaken For Stars "Up In Them Guts"
Racetrack "City Lights" (Face melting power-pop.)
Toys That Kill "Control The Sun"
USS Horsewhip "Wants You Dead" (Blatant self-promotion.)
Wrangler Brutes "zulu"
